Australian Made & Played Live is a double album of performances from the 2002–2006 Australian Made & Played concerts. It’s packed with great performances and unexpected collaborations. Most importantly, the album is a great showcase of our amazing instrument makers and their work.

The album has been heartily supported by both artists and makers, who are sometimes the same person!

It includes a mammoth 25 tracks with stand-out and unusual performances such as Bob Brozman performing with Mark Aspland in Bob’s first percussion recording and a rare solo performance from The Waif’s Josh Cunningham.

Other highlights include performances from the Pigram Brothers with Shane Howard and Ian Noyce, Michael McGoldrick of Capercaillie with Jim Murray (Sharon Shannon Band, Séamus Begley) and Tony McMannus, Mia Dyson, mandolin legends Stephen Gilchrist and Grammy award-winner Mike Compton (of O Brother, Where Art Thou? fame, John Hartford, Ralph Stanley) plus many more wonderful performances.
